【A common used C++ DAG framework】 一个通用的、无三方依赖的、跨平台的、收录于awesome-cpp的、基于流图的并行计算框架。欢迎star & fork & 交流 www.chunel.cn Topics flowworkflowaipipelinegraphdagthreadpooltaskflow Resources Readme License
$gitclonehttps://github.com/ChunelFeng/CGraph.git$cdCGraph/$cmake . -Bbuild$cdbuild/$make 三. 使用Demo MyNode1.h #include"../../src/CGraph.h"classMyNode1:publicCGraph::GNode {public:CSTATUSrun()override{ CSTATUS status = STATUS_OK; CGraph::CGRAPH_ECHO("[%s], enter MyNode1...
.github cmake doc example proto src test tutorial .gitattributes .gitignore CGraph-build.sh CGraph-docker-env.sh CGraph-ninja-build.sh CGraph-run-examples.sh CGraph-run-functional-tests.sh CGraph-run-performance-tests.sh CGraph-run-tutorials.sh CMakeLists.txt COMPILE.md CONTRIBUTORS.md ...
推荐进入以下网页,以获取更好的阅读体验 大家好,我是不会写代码的纯序员——Chunel Feng。大概一年之前,有位自动驾驶行业的朋友在github上看到CGraph这个项目,然后联系到我,问我小破图执行的时候,能否执行完节点A之后,后面的节点B开始执行的同时,A节点继续执行。后来,又有一位百度做视频流处理的朋友,找我问… ...
'CGraph - 简单好用的、无任何三方依赖的、跨平台的、收录于awesome-cpp的、基于流图的并行计算框架' Chunel GitHub: github.com/ChunelFeng/CGraph #开源##机器学习# û收藏 27 6 ñ24 评论 o p 同时转发到我的微博 按热度 按时间 正在加载,请稍候... 互联网科技博主 ...
开始之前,先上源码链接:https://github.com/ChunelFeng/CGraph 性能对比 我们来看一下各个指标上具体的性能对比。主要分为多线程并发处理、长链路串行执行、模拟真实dag使用这三个部分。 多线程并发处理 在并发处理层面,我们选用的是32节点同时并发执行,循环执行 50w次, 均开8线程处理。
HelloGitHub 22-03-3 21:20 来自微博网页版 CGraph 无第三方依赖的 DAG 调度框架。实现了依赖节点依次执行、无依赖节点并发执行的逻辑。项目结构清晰、文档齐全,不仅代码中包含关键注释,还有示例代码和讲解文章。初学者可以通过该项目学到图调度方式、模块开发、模板编程、多线程编程、设计模式和通用算法的知识。项目...
一个Linux目录或者文件,都会有一个所有者、所属组和其他用户。所有者是指文件的拥有者,而所属组指的...
開發者ID:RichardRohac,項目名稱:hl-amnesia-src, 注:本文中的CGraph::AllocNodes方法示例由純淨天空整理自Github/MSDocs等開源代碼及文檔管理平台,相關代碼片段篩選自各路編程大神貢獻的開源項目,源碼版權歸原作者所有,傳播和使用請參考對應項目的License;未經允許,請勿轉載。
开发者ID:caomw,项目名称:upgmpp,代码行数:81,代码来源:CGraph.hpp 注:本文中的CGraph::addNode方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。